Miller Pipeline Reports Data Security Incident from Early 2026

Miller Pipeline has reported a data security incident that occurred on February 12, 2026. Official filings indicate an investigation is underway regarding the exposure of personal information. Individuals who may be affected should stay informed about any direct communications from the company.

Miller Pipeline, based in Indiana, recently filed notice of a data security incident. This event, which potentially exposed personal information, was identified as occurring on February 12, 2026. The official report detailing this incident was submitted on April 2, 2026. The nature of the breach itself, as well as the specific types of personal information involved, have not been detailed in the public filing. Miller Pipeline has stated that an investigation into the incident is actively in progress to understand the full scope of what occurred. If you receive a direct notification from Miller Pipeline, it will provide more specific details about how you may be affected and what information might have been involved. Such notices are the primary source for personalized guidance following a data security event. As a general precaution, it is advisable to remain vigilant for any unusual activity across your online accounts. Consider monitoring financial statements and credit reports for unauthorized transactions or suspicious inquiries. Be cautious of unsolicited communications that request personal details.
